Residential roof projects tend to set you back between $5,000 $20,000 relying on a great deal of aspects, such as: How numerous square feet is the roofing? How numerous layers of tiles are mosting likely to be applied? Does any kind of deck job require to be fixed before anything is mounted? Just how quickly does the task requirement to be done? Just how high is your home airborne? All of the variables consist of fluctuations in labor, time, or material, which include up to the price of the project.

Residential roofing systems can be low-slope or high-slope (extremely hardly ever will there be a level roofing). They generally set up tile roofing systems. Metal roof covering is making use of large steel panels that are set up over the insulation on a roof. The majority of steel roof use corrugated galvanized steel, although various other materials visit this site such as aluminum or tin can additionally be made use of.

Shingles are mainly for residential housing as a result of visual appeals, however they are additionally common in other structures such as churches as well as barns. Shingles can be made from wood, slate, metal, plastic, ceramic, and composite products such as asphalt. The most effective part regarding tiles roofs is that there are lots of service providers who can mount them, as well as there are lots of alternatives when it comes to colors as well as design.

One more advantage is that silicone roofing system layers are thought about a repair service and also not an additional roof system. This is vital for roofing systems that currently have 2 or even more roof mounted. Due to constructing codes specifying that the optimum quantity of roof systems an industrial roofing system can have is 2, an entire roofing system may need to be gotten rid of to install any kind of other roof besides silicone finishing.
